
.empty,.norecord { text-align: center; font-size: 14px; color: #bbb; padding: 140px 16px 30px 0px; line-height: 24px;background: url(empty.png) no-repeat 50% 30px; } 
/*.header { width:100% } 
.header-nav { width:1180px; margin:0 auto; height:97px; line-height:97px } 
.header-nav>.f-l>ul>li { text-align:center; height:20px; line-height:20px; display:inline-block; color:#333; font-size:16px; margin-left:30px } 
.header-nav>.f-l>ul>li:first-child { width:144px; height:45px; line-height:45px; display:inline-block; font-size:32px; margin-left:0 } 
.header-nav>.f-l>ul>li:first-child>a { display:block } */
.news { position:relative; width:25px; padding-top:30px; font-size:14px; color:#666 } 
.news>i { position:absolute; width:18px; height:18px; font-size:16px; color:#0081dc; top:-30px; left:0; margin-left:6px } 
i { font-style: normal; } 
.notice { position:relative } 
.mt25 { margin-top:25px } 
.mt15 { margin-top:15px } 
.mt10 { margin-top:10px } 
.mb25 { margin-bottom:25px } 
.pl15 { padding-left:15px } 
.black { color:#000 } 
.f-78 { color:#da0808 } 
.c-bf { color:#bfbfbf } 
.c-f90 { color:#ff90bb } 
.notice-scorll { height:38px; line-height:38px; background:url(../common/rgba0-30.png); } 
.notice-scorll>span { color:#fff; font-size:14px; display:block; width:60%; margin:0 auto } 
.w60 { width:60%; margin:0 auto } 
.mt30 { margin-top:30px } 
.notice { background:#f5f5f5; padding: 40px 0 20px; } 
.notice-l h2 { font-size:28px; color:#333; margin-bottom:15px; font-weight:400; line-height:38px; } 
.notice-l .price { color:#888; font-size: 14px; color:#888; margin-bottom:15px } 
.notice-l .classTeacher { line-height: 31px; color: #999; margin-right: 20px; } 
.notice-l p i { font-size:18px; margin-right:5px; } 

.notice-l .classTeacher i { display: inline-block; color: #fff; font-size: 12px; background:#0288d1; width: 22px; height: 22px; line-height: 22px; text-align: center; border-radius: 3px 0 0 3px; margin-right:0; vertical-align:middle; } 
.notice-l .classTeacher span { border: 1px solid #ddd; height: 20px; line-height: 20px; padding: 0 8px 0 5px; font-size: 12px; color: #999; display: inline-block; border-radius: 0 3px 3px 0; border-left: 0; vertical-align: middle; } 

.buttonbox { display:inline-block; padding:10px 12px; margin-bottom:0; font-size:16px; font-weight:400; line-height:1.42857143; text-align:center; white-space:nowrap; vertical-align:middle; -ms-touch-action:manipulation; touch-action:manipulation; cursor:pointer; -webkit-user-select:none; -moz-user-select:none; -ms-user-select:none; user-select:none; background-image:none; border:1px solid transparent; border-radius:4px; background:#ff9f37; color:#fff; transition: .3s; } 
.buttonbox:hover { background:#ff9f37; } 
.btn-check { background-color:#ff6029; color:#fff; border-color:#ff6029 } 
.btn-default { background-color:#ffede3; color:#ff6029; border-color:#ffede3 } 
.btn-win { min-width:150px } 
.mr40 { margin-right:40px } 
.container { margin-top:60px } 

.container-l { padding:20px; width:75%; border: 1px solid #eee; background: #fff; float: left; border-radius: 5px; box-sizing: border-box; } 
.container-nav { position: relative; border-bottom: 1px solid #f5f5f5; margin-bottom: 20px; } 
.container-nav li { float:left; } 
.container-nav li { height:36px; width: 16.66%; line-height:36px; padding-bottom:10px; text-align:center; font-size:16px; color:#5b5b5b; cursor: pointer; } 
.container-nav .on { color:#0288d1; /*border-bottom: 2px solid #0288d1; */ } 

.iframe-InfoL { margin-right:-20px; } 

.w45 { width:1180px; margin:0 auto; box-sizing:border-box } 
.iframe-box>ul>li { width:33.3333%; float:left } 
.iframe-box>ul>li>.title-top { margin-right:20px; padding:10px 0; color:#888; text-align:center; } 
.work-bg { /*background-color:#35a0da; */ background:#f5f5f5; } 
.answer-bg { /*background-color:#35a0da; */ background:#f5f5f5; } 
.news-bg { /*background-color:#35a0da; */ background:#f5f5f5; } 
.title-top>label { display:inline-block; font-size:15px; text-align:left; } 
.title-top>i { display:inline-block; vertical-align:top; font-size:40px } 
.second-ul { margin-right: 20px; padding: 10px 15px; border: 1px solid #eee; border-top: 0; min-height: 60px; } 
.second-ul>li { height:30px; line-height:30px; font-size:12px; } 
.second-ul>li a { color:#666; } 
.second-ul>li i { color:#888; } 

.class-title { height:46px; line-height:46px; border-bottom: 1px solid #eee; } 
.class-title>ul { min-height:300px } 
.class-title>h2 { color:#343433; font-size:16px; font-weight:400; border-bottom: 2px solid #ff9f37; letter-spacing: 1px; } 
.class-title>a { position:relative; padding-right:30px } 
.class-title>a:after { content:''; position:absolute; height:10px; width:16px; background:url(../images/more-icon.png) no-repeat; display:block; top:17px; right:10px } 
.class-p>ul>li { width:33.3333%; float:left } 
.class-box { margin-right:30px; position:relative } 
.class-box img { width:100%; display:block; height:160px; } 
.class-txt>p>label { font-size: 14px; line-height: 30px; height: 30px; display: block; white-space: nowrap; text-overflow: ellipsis; overflow: hidden; } 
.class-txt p { margin-top:10px; line-height: 26px; } 
.btn-fix { float:right; text-align:center; padding:2px 10px; font-size:12px; line-height:20px; white-space:nowrap; cursor:pointer; min-width:60px; background-image:none; border:1px solid transparent; border-radius:3px; } 
.btn-color { background-color:#fff; border-color:#35a0da; color:#35a0da; display: none; } 
.group-p>ul { margin-top:20px } 
.group-p>ul>li { width:50%; float:left; } 
.group-p>ul>li:nth-of-type(odd)>a { margin-right:20px } 
.group-p>ul>li>a { position:relative; padding:15px; padding-left:105px; display:block; } 
.group-img { position:absolute; width:73px; height:73px; left:15px; border-radius: 5px; } 
.group-txt1 { font-size:16px; color:#686868; margin-bottom: 10px; } 
.group-txt2 { font-size: 12px; color: #999; margin-bottom: 10px; } 
.group-txt3 { font-size: 12px; color: #888; height: 50px; line-height: 25px; overflow: hidden; } 

.famous-p li { width:25%; float:left } 
.famous-p>ul>li a { background:#f7f7f7; text-align:center; display: block; padding:20px 0 0; height:170px; overflow:hidden } 
.famous-p>ul>li a img { vertical-align:middle; width:100px; height:100px; border-radius:50%; } 
.famous-txt p { line-height:24px; font-size:14px; margin-top:5px; } 
.famous-txt p:last-child { font-size:12px; color:#999; height: 24px; overflow: hidden; text-overflow: ellipsis; white-space: nowrap; } 
.famous-box2 { padding:10px 15px; font-size:12px; color:#888; white-space:nowrap; text-overflow:ellipsis; -o-text-overflow:ellipsis; overflow: hidden; height:20px; line-height:20px; text-overflow: ellipsis; white-space: nowrap; } 
.famous-box3 { margin:10px; border:1px solid #ededed; border-radius:5px; overflow: hidden; } 

.newsstudent-p li { width:16.66%; float:left } 
.newsstudent-p .newsstudent-box img { width:70px; height:70px; border-radius:50%; overflow:hidden } 
.newsstudent-p .newsstudent-box a { display:inline-block; padding-top:20px; text-align:center; margin-left:20px; width:140px; } 
#classcommittee .newsstudent-box img { display: block; width: 40px; height: 40px; object-fit: cover; border-radius: 40px; float: left; margin-right: 15px; } 
#classcommittee .famous-txt { width: calc(100% - 55px); float: right; } 
.newsstudent-txt { text-align:left; padding:0 10px; color: #888; display: none; } 
.notice-l { position:relative; background: #fff; border-radius:5px; border:1px solid #eee; } 
.classImg { width: 50%; height:350px; overflow:hidden; } 
.classImg img { width:100%; display:block; min-height:100%; } 
.classInfo { width:50%; } 
.classData { padding: 11px 0; margin-bottom: 0; background-color: #fafafa; } 
.classData li { float:left; width:33.33%; text-align:center; margin: 10px 0; color: #919191; line-height: 30px; border-left: 1px solid #f0f0f0; box-sizing:border-box; } 
.classInfoTop,.classBottom { margin-left:40px; margin-top: 30px; } 
.dataNum i { font-size:20px; color:#999; } 
.dataText { font-size:14px; } 
.classData li:first-child { border-left:0; } 
.classData li:nth-child(2) .dataNum i { font-size:22px; } 


.notice-l .price strong { font-size:24px; font-weight: normal; color: #da0808; } 
.notice-l .price em { text-decoration: line-through; margin-left: 20px; color:#999; } 

#cover { position:fixed; z-index:9999; top:0; left:0; display:none; width:100%; height:100%; opacity:.5; background:#000 none repeat scroll 0 0 } 
.notice-bg { background:url(../images/notice-bg722.png) no-repeat; background-size:100% 100%; display:none; width:50%; position:absolute; left:50%; margin-left:-25%; z-index:10000; top:25%; min-height:300px } 
.notice-bg>p { position:absolute; width:60%; top:80px; line-height:32px; left:80px; font-size:16px; color:#fff } 
/*.common-title { height:20px; line-height:20px; text-indent:20px } 
.common-title>h4 { font-size:20px; color:#3ab57f; position:relative; font-weight:400 } 
.common-title>h4:before { content:''; width:2px; background-color:#3ab57f; display:block; position:absolute; height:20px } */
.brief>p { font-size:14px; text-indent:20px; margin-top:35px; line-height:32px; color:#5b5b5b } 
.tabs>ul { border-bottom:1px solid #ccc } 
.tabs>ul>li { width:84px; text-align:center; height:32px; line-height:32px; float:left } 
.tabs>ul>.active { background-color:#74cd55 } 
.tabs>ul>.active>a { color:#fff } 
.tabs>ul>li>a { display:block; font-size:16px } 
.tab-content>.tab-item>ul>li { height:36px; line-height:36px; font-size:14px; padding:5px 10px; border-bottom: 1px solid #eee; } 
.tab-content>.tab-item>ul>li>a { display:block; } 
.tab-content>.tab-item>ul>li>a:hover { color:#0288d1 } 
.mb15 { margin-bottom:15px } 
.tab-item .icon { font-size:24px!important; color:#949494; padding-right:10px } 
.tab-item span { color:#9a9a9a; font-size:14px; padding-left:15px } 
.iframe-box .class-box,.iframe-box .famous-box3 { margin-bottom:15px; margin-top:10px; } 
.iframe-box .newsstudent-p .newsstudent-box a { margin-bottom:30px } 
.iframe-box { min-height:450px } 
#classroomview,#courselist { margin-right:-30px; } 
.ask_lis li { position:relative } 
.ask_listb .ask_lis li .lct { top:0!important } 
.aui_title div { text-align:center!important } 
.aui_title { border-bottom:1px solid #eee } 

.pj_box { margin-top:20px; } 
.content_box1 .content_1 .tab_course .commentList .load_more { text-align:center; font-size:14px } 
.content_box1 .content_1 .tab_course .commentList .load_more a { color:#777 } 
.pj_box_textarea { padding-left:10px; line-height:28px; border:1px solid #eee; outline:0; border-radius:3px; font-size:14px; resize:none; height:80px; width:250px; margin:10px 0 } 

.comment-con { float:left } 
.user-txt { line-height:35px; font-size:12px } 
.comment-txt { line-height:22px; font-size:12px } 
.second-ul .empty { display:none } 
/*班级内容页*/
.ask_lis .askcontbox .asklist { margin-top:15px; } 
.ask_lis li { padding:15px 0px; min-height:50px; position:relative; } 
.ask_lis li:after { content:"."; display:block; height:0; clear:both; visibility:hidden } 
.ask_lis li .lct { width:45px; position:absolute; left:0; top:15px; } 
.ask_lis li .lct img { width:45px; height:45px; border-radius:50% } 
.ask_lis li .rct { padding-left:60px; } 
.ask_lis li .rct .rname { font-size:12px; color:#808080 } 
.ask_lis li .rct .rname span { padding-left:15px; font-size:12px; color:#c1c1c1; } 
.ask_lis li .rct .rinfo { margin-top:10px; font-size:14px; line-height:26px; color:#444; *overflow:hidden; } 
.ask_lis li .rct .rinfo img { max-width:100%; } 
.ask_lis li .rct .rbtn { width:55px; height:27px; line-height:26px; color:#808080; text-align:center; margin-top:10px; background:url(hfbtn.png) no-repeat; float:right; cursor:pointer; } 
.ask_lis li .rct .replylist { margin-top: 10px; background: #fffcf0; border: 1px solid #eee5c2; } 
.ask_lis li .rct .replylist.reply0 { display:none; } 
.ask_lis li .rct .replylist .replybox { padding: 15px 10px 15px 0px; border-top: 1px solid #eee5c2; position: relative; margin: -1px 0px 0px 15px; } 
.ask_lis .replylist .empty { display:none } 
.ask_lis .rtalklist { background: url(bg03.png) no-repeat 100% 0; padding: 21px 0px 12px 0px; overflow: hidden; height: 120px; margin-top: 9px; position: relative; -moz-animation: mybyjc 3s; -webkit-animation: mybyjc 3s; -o-animation: mybyjc 3s; } 
.ask_lis li .rct .rname span { padding-left: 15px; font-size: 12px; color: #c1c1c1; } 
.ask_lis .replylist .replybox { padding: 15px 10px 15px 0px; border-top: 1px solid #eee; position: relative; margin: -1px 0px 0px 15px; } 
.ask_lis .replylist .replybox span { display: block; color: #c1c1c1; } 
.ask_lis .replylist .replybox .talkinfo { line-height: 26px; padding-right: 10px; font-size: 14px; margin-top: 6px; color: #444; } 
.ask_lis .replylist .replybox span font { float: right; } 
.ask_lis .replylist .replybox span em { color: #c1c1c1; font-size: 12px; padding-left: 15px; display: none; } 
.ask_lis .rtalklist .textareabox { padding-right: 22px; } 
.ask_lis .rtalklist .textareabox textarea { width: 100%; height: 60px; padding: 10px; line-height: 20px; font-size: 14px; border: 1px solid #e3e3e3; font-family: "\5FAE\8F6F\96C5\9ED1"; color: #808080; outline: none; display: block; overflow: hidden; margin-bottom: 0; border-radius: 0; resize:none; } 
.ask_lis .rtalklist .hfbox { background: #f5f5f5; height: 35px; padding-left: 10px; border: 1px solid #e3e3e3; border-top: 0px; line-height: 35px; } 
.ask_lis .rtalklist .hfbox .hfbtn { width: 90px; height: 35px; line-height: 100%; background: #60a3e1; cursor: pointer; font-size: 14px; float: right; font-family: "\5FAE\8F6F\96C5\9ED1"; color: #fff; border: 1px solid #5598d5; outline:none; } 
.ask_lis .rtalklist .hfbox span { font-size: 12px; float: left; color: #808080; line-height: 35px; } 
.ask_lis .rtalklist .hfbox span font { font-size: 12px; color: #d00; } 
.askbtn { width:80px; height:25px; vertical-align:middle; background:#188EEE; border:0; color:#fff; cursor:pointer; -webkit-transition:.3s; transition:.3s; outline:0 } 
.newsstudent-txt p { text-align:center; line-height:20px; heigh:20px } 
.ask_box { margin:10px 0; } 
.ask_btnbox { margin-top:15px } 
#classroomhomework i { font-size:14px; padding-right:10px; } 
#classroomhomework .buttonbox { padding:2px 10px } 
.mt10 { margin-top; 10px } 


.comment-course-info { position:absolute; right:20px; top:40px } 
.tab-item { marhin-top:10px } 

.containerBottom { margin-bottom:20px; } 

.container-r { width:25%; float: right; box-sizing: border-box; padding-left: 20px; } 
.coniframe-box { background: #fff; padding: 15px; border: 1px solid #eee; margin-bottom: 20px; border-radius: 5px; } 
.coniframe-box .coniframe-title { font-size: 16px; padding: 0px 0 10px; line-height: 30px; background: #fff; border-bottom: 1px solid #f5f5f5; } 
.coniframe-title h4 { font-weight: normal; } 

#classroomstudent li { width:20%; float:left; } 
#classroomstudent li img { width:30px; height:30px; border-radius:30px; display: block; margin:auto; } 
#classroomstudent li .famous-txt { text-align:center; margin:0 5px; } 

#classroomteacher li { width:33.33%; float:left; } 
#classroomteacher .famous-box3 { border:0; border-radius:0; } 
 {
 } 
#classroomteacher .famous-box3 img { width:100%; display: block; height: 60px; border-radius: 5px; } 
#classroomteacher .famous-txt p { display:none; } 
#classroomteacher .famous-txt p:first-child { display:block; text-align:center; font-size:12px; color: #999; } 
#classroomteacher .famous-box2 { display:none; } 

#classroomgroup li { width:33.33%; float:left; margin-top:10px; } 
#classroomgroup li a { position: relative; margin: 10px; display: block; } 
#classroomgroup li .group-txt p { display:none; } 
#classroomgroup li .group-img,#classroomgroup li .btn-fix { position:static; } 
#classroomgroup li .group-img { width:100%; height:60px; border-radius:60px; } 
#classroomgroup li .btn-fix { min-width:100%; padding:2px 0; text-align:center; margin-top: 5px; } 
#classroomgroup li .btn-color { border-color: #dedede; color: #999; } 
